Scottsdale TR™ putters are named for the "true roll" they provide as the result of PING’s innovative new variable-depth-groove technology. Grooves are deepest in the center and get gradually shallower toward the perimeter to equalize ball speeds for exceptional distance control on putts struck on the center, heel or toe. Adjustable-length shafts help optimize performance, and 12 models fit every stroke type.
By varying the groove depths, putts roll nearly identical distances on center, heel or toe strikes. The grooves are deeper in the middle and shallower toward the perimeter, which produces similar ball speed across the entire face.
Traditional-length models adjust from 31 to 38 inches; belly models range from 37.5 to 46.5 inches, and long models from 44.5 to 55.5 inches. Adjustability optimizes the fit and maximizes performance.
When compared to a non-groove insert, putts hit with the Scottsdale TR insert in the center, heel or toe travel nearly the same distance. The varying groove depths produce similar ball speeds and distances for improved consistency, the key to holing more putts.

Variable-depth grooves in the insert are deepest in the center and get gradually shallower to the perimeter to equalize ball speeds across the putter face for more consistent distance control. PING studies show an increase in ball-speed consistency of nearly 50% when measured at the nine points across the center, heel and toe. The insert is made from a lightweight 6061 aerospace grade aluminum that provides a solid feel and sound similar to that of a traditional steel face.
This comprehensive family offers 12 models in blade designs, mid-mallets and mallets. Adjustable-length, USGA/R&A-conforming shafts adjust 31" to 38" in standard models (optional). In belly models the range is 37.5" to 46.5", and in long models from 44.5" to 55.5". Adjustability allows you to modify the length to fit your posture and your putting style prior to a round. Putters fit all three stroke types: straight, slight arc, and strong arc, which are easily identified by color-coded shaft labels. Results from hundreds of player and robot tests at PING show that you’ll putt more consistently when your putter balance matches your stroke type. A variety of head shapes with white sightlines make aiming easier for improved accuracy. The rich black PVD finish is non-glare to eliminate distractions.
